The Pact.
Freedom isn’t the same as Liberty.
But Liberty treads the path,
To enlightenment.
Both are imposters,
Tickled into the ears,
Of people with long memories.
Those in charge,
In the high places,
Will make their sacrifices.
And it’s evident,
Those in charge will always be,
Those in charge.
The best we can expect,
Rightfully, our only demand,
Is fair dealing.
The best they,
Can hope for,
Is to keep their heads.
But a reminder may be needed,
Of the year of our Lord,
Twelve Fifteen.
By: W.N. Branson
